If gas A has four times the molar mass of gas B, you would expect it to diffuse through a plug ___________.

  • A. at half the rate of gas B
  • B. at twice the rate of gas B
  • C. at a quarter the rate of gas B
  • D. at four times the rate of gas B
Correct Answer: A

Rationale: When comparing the diffusion rates of two gases, according to Graham's law of diffusion, the rate of diffusion is inversely proportional to the square root of the molar mass. If gas A has four times the molar mass of gas B, the square root of the molar masses ratio (4:1) is 2. This means that gas A would diffuse through a plug at half the rate of gas B. Therefore, the correct answer is A, at half the rate of gas B.
